City Seeks Public Input on Water and Wastewater Assets
Posted on Tuesday, June 13, 2023 04:06 PM
As part of the process to update the Asset Management Plan (AMP), the City of Thunder Bay is seeking public feedback through two public surveys focused on Municipal Water and Wastewater services.

City Parks Facilities Kick Off Summer Operations
Posted on Friday, June 02, 2023 05:52 PM
Summer in Thunder Bay has officially kicked off with the opening of City campgrounds and amusement rides.
Tent sites, RV sites and cabins are now available to rent as the campgrounds at Trowbridge Falls and Chippewa Park open for the camping season today.

Free compost available to residents
Posted on Friday, May 19, 2023 05:09 PM
Compost is available to all residents at no charge at the Solid Waste and Recycling Facility while quantities last, weather permitting, beginning today.
